As part of my acceptance speech for the "Donkey of the Tournament Award" for Donking off all my chips at the final table with 7-2 off I thought I would at least share my ill conceived plan.

The final table started out tight and when I picked up 7-2 and it was Tim's blind, I thought I would have some fun. The plan---fire out a 4x BB bet, have everyone fold and then show my 7-2 to bust Tim's chops. However, I got a caller (oops, not part of the plan). OK, no problem, I'll push him off his piece of cheese that was only worth a call with a half pot continuation bet. Oops, he calls! Now I check and he checks back and the river makes the second pair on board but the flush didn't make it. I know I'm toast for a check/check showdown so I decide to push. Oops again ... and as the say, three oops and you're out. What started out as a lark to have fun with Tim's big blind became my undoing. It will be highlighted in my up and coming book, "When Great Plans Run off the Rails". one for each "Oops".

My other excuse is that I had a brain fart and thought I was on High Stakes Poker and the "7-2" was on! Either way nobody can call me a nit!
